Product Description:
The MS2N05-B0BTN-CMSG1-NNNNN-Z1 Synchronous Servo Motor combines fast dynamics with advanced encoder feedback. It provides a robust mechanical interface with a flange size of 98 mm. It operates efficiently with a maximum speed of 6000 revolutions per minute.
This MS2N05-B0BTN-CMSG1-NNNNN-Z1 servo motor features a maximum torque of 11.5 Nm at 20 °C and a standstill torque of 3.75 Nm under 60 K conditions. It is capable of operating at a rated current of 3.12 A under 100 K thermal conditions. The winding resistance of the motor at 20 °C is 2.7 Ohms and the voltage constant is 54.2 V per 1000 min⁻¹. It supports five pole pairs for precise motion control. The motor has a rotor moment of inertia of 0.00028 kg·m² which enables quick acceleration and deceleration. It uses a self cooling method to maintain temperature efficiency without requiring additional components. The thermal time constant for the winding is 21.2 seconds while the motor body has a thermal time constant of 12.7 minutes. The integrated brake in this servo motor has a holding torque of 10.00 Nm with a rated voltage of 24 V and rated current of 0.73 A. These specifications support high holding force during standby or powered off states.
The encoder system incorporated in this Bosch MS2N05-B0BTN-CMSG1-NNNNN-Z1 servo motor is based on ACUROlink and offers 20 bit resolution with multiturn capability up to 4096 revolutions. This ensures precise feedback for positioning systems. The MS2N series servo motor has a 19 mm shaft diameter and 30 mm shaft length. The centering collar diameter of the motor is 95 mm with a hole circle diameter of 115 mm. Mounting holes are 9 mm in diameter that ensures secure installation.
